The Department of Languages, Histories and Cultures Studies at Bethune-Cookman University invites applications for a tenure-track Assistant Professor in History, beginning in August 2019. Preferred candidates will have experience teaching general history courses, African-American History, or Public History. Preferred candidates will also demonstrate a commitment to excellence in research, teaching and service. A Ph.D. in History is required at the time of appointment. The position also requires the ability to mentor students.
